Frequently asked questions

How many federal alcohol permits are in Pennsylvania?

Pennsylvania has 2,428 active federal alcohol Basic Permits - 619 wineries, 320 distilleries, 489 importers, and 1,000 wholesalers. That is the 7th most of any U.S. state or territory.

What is Pennsylvania's per-capita permit rate?

Pennsylvania has 18.7 federal alcohol permits per 100,000 residents (U.S. Census Vintage-2023 population), ranking 28th by density. Per-capita rates are high in wine- and spirits-producing states with smaller populations.

Which Pennsylvania city has the most permit holders?

Philadelphia leads Pennsylvania with 273 federal alcohol permit holders, followed by Pittsburgh, Harrisburg, Lancaster.

Are breweries included?

No. Breweries do not hold an FAA Basic Permit, they operate under a Brewer's Notice (IRC §6103, protected from disclosure), so they are not in the public TTB List of Permittees this directory is built from.
